Gwyneth Paltrow describes her recollection of a 2016 ski crash

Gwyneth Paltrow describes her recollection of a 2016 ski crash while testifying in Park City, Utah on March 24, 2023. (Law&Crime Network)

Gwyneth Paltrow originally, but only briefly, thought her 2016 ski crash with a retired optometrist might have been a sexual assault, the actress testified in court in Utah late Friday afternoon.

Kristin Van Orman, an attorney for the plaintiff Terry Sanderson, asked the Academy Award-winning defendant about her recollection of the incident on the slopes about midway through direct examination – going through Paltrow’s 2020 deposition over an overruled objection.
